REPUBLIC ACT NO.

3571
AN ACT TO PROHIBIT THE CUTTING, DESTROYING
OR INJURING OF PLANTED OR GROWING TREES,
FLOWERING PLANTS AND SHRUBS OR PLANTS OF
SCENIC VALUE ALONG PUBLIC ROADS, IN PLAZAS,
PARKS, SCHOOL PREMISES
OR IN ANY OTHER PUBLIC GROUND.
SECTION 1
it is the policy of the Government to cherish,
protect and conserve planted or growing trees,
flowering plants and shrubs or plants of
ornamental value along public roads, in plazas,
parks, school premises or in any public ground.
SECTION 2

For the purpose of carrying out effectively the provisions


of this Act, the Director of Parks and Wildlife shall have
the power to create a committee in each and every
municipality in the Philippines and shall appoint any civic
conscious and well-travelled citizen as chairman, and
the municipal mayor, the municipal treasurer, the
supervising school teacher, and the municipal health
officer, as ex-officio members thereof. The Director of
Parks and Wildlife shall also have the power to issue
and promulgate rules and regulations as may be
necessary in carrying out the provisions of this Act.
SECTION 3

No cutting, destroying, or injuring of planted or


growing trees, flowering plants and shrubs or plants
of scenic value along public roads, in plazas parks,
school premises or in any other public ground shall
be permitted save when the cutting, destroying, or
injuring of same is necessary for public safety, or
such pruning of same is necessary to enhance its
beauty and only upon the recommendation of the
committee mentioned in the preceding section, and
upon the approval of the Director of Parks and
Wildlife. The cutting, destroying, or pruning shall be
under the supervision of
the committee.
SECTION 4
Any person who shall cut, destroy or
injure trees, flowering plants and shrubs
or plants of scenic value mentioned in
the preceding sections of this Act, shall
be punished by prison correctional in its
minimum period to prison mayor in its
minimum period.
SECTION 5
All laws, Acts, parts of Acts, executive
orders, and administrative orders or
regulations inconsistent with the provisions
of this Act, are hereby repealed.

The application for special permit to cut trees,
particularly protected hardwoods, inside public school
grounds and in private land, is usually acted upon by
DENR authorities only upon compliance of certain
requisites, or upon submission among others of the
following:
1. Vicinity map and sketch of the area where the trees to be cut are
located
2. Inventory of the trees to be cut which covers
a. Number and species
b. Diameter and height of each tree and estimated volume of timber
to be generated
c. Estimate of total volume in board feet of cut lumbers/woods and
their estimated value
d. Utilization plan of the cut timbers
3. Infrastructure/physical development plan of the area where the
trees are found
4. Building permit
5. Community consultation on the cutting of trees
6. Confirmatory assessment by DENR environmental officers of the
site and the trees to be cut
Once compliance is made, DENR may issue
the permit to the requesting party often
with certain conditions,

• possibility of saving some trees by


moving the construction of the building
a little away from premium trees, or by
earth-balling and relocating the trees;

• the submission of a replanting plan for


the replacement of the felled trees;
• fixing the schedule or timeframe of tree
cutting;

• and the supervision of the cutting by


the CENRO or other DENR environment
officer.
The offenders and/or persons
liable and subject to arrest
• the cutter, gatherer, collector, receiver,
and the possessor, or in the case of a
corporation, the officer or officers who
appear to be responsible to the
commission of the offense.
Penalty
• The violation of RA 3571 is punishable
by prison correctional in its minimum
period to prison mayor in its minimum
period.
